Comprehensive Character Coverage and Design Philosophy
What truly sets this addon apart from typical font replacements is the sheer completeness of its character set. Many custom fonts available for download only replace basic Latin characters, leaving numbers, punctuation, or special symbols looking disjointed and out of place. In contrast, when you download Ashen 16x Custom Font - Stylish Serif Font for Minecraft, you are installing a fully realized typeface that covers every printable character supported by the vanilla engine.
The design language draws heavily from traditional calligraphy, featuring pronounced serifs that give each letter a hand-crafted appearance. Imagine text written with a quill on aged parchment; this is the exact vibe the font brings to your HUD. Beyond standard English letters and numerals, the pack meticulously redesigns the Illager alphabet found on ominous banners and the Standard Galactic Alphabet used in the Enchanting Table interface. These specialized scripts are rendered in the same stylistic vein, ensuring that magical runes and alien symbols feel like they belong to the same world as your chat logs and item tooltips.
A notable design decision involves the handling of Unicode characters outside the core Minecraft set, such as Devanagari or other complex scripts. The author chose not to override these system-generated glyphs. This approach preserves the integrity of the operating system's rendering for exotic languages while ensuring that the core game experience remains visually consistent. It is a thoughtful compromise that prevents potential rendering errors while keeping the aesthetic authentic where it matters most.
Seamless Compatibility and Layering Strategy
One of the primary concerns when installing resource packs is conflict management. Players often worry that a specific font pack will clash with their favorite high-definition texture packs or thematic overlays. The Ashen 16x Custom Font - Stylish Serif Font for Minecraft is engineered to function harmoniously alongside almost any other resource pack in existence. Because it focuses exclusively on font definition files rather than block textures or entity models, it acts as a universal overlay.
To achieve the desired effect, proper load order is essential. When configuring your active resources, you must place this font pack at the very top of the list. In Minecraft's resource loading hierarchy, packs located higher up take precedence over those below them. By positioning the Ashen font above your terrain textures, GUI modifications, or skyboxes, you ensure that the stylish serif typeface overrides the default vanilla font and any conflicting typography from other packs. This allows you to pair a medieval font with a futuristic sci-fi texture pack or a realistic survival suite, creating unique visual combinations that were previously difficult to achieve.
It is worth noting that while the pack is highly compatible with standard image-based font replacements, interactions with mods that inject TrueType (.ttf) files directly into the renderer may vary. Since the author primarily tested the addon against vanilla and standard resource pack environments, users employing deep-level font injection mods should test for visual discrepancies. However, for the vast majority of players using standard Forge or Fabric loaders with conventional resource packs, the integration is flawless.

Installation Guide and Configuration
Installing this resource pack is a straightforward process that requires no external mod loaders, although it works perfectly well with them. If you are wondering how to install this typographic upgrade, simply follow these steps to integrate it into your game client:
- Begin by acquiring the file; ensure you download Ashen 16x Custom Font - Stylish Serif Font for Minecraft from a trusted source to avoid corrupted files.
- Locate your Minecraft installation directory and navigate to the
resourcepacksfolder. On Windows, this is typically found under %appdata%\.minecraft\resourcepacks. - Move the downloaded zip archive directly into this folder. There is no need to extract the contents unless you plan on editing the files manually.
- Launch Minecraft and navigate to the Options menu, then select Resource Packs.
- You should see the Ashen font pack listed on the left side. Hover over its icon and click the arrow button to move it to the "Selected" column on the right.
- Crucial Step: Ensure that the Ashen font pack is positioned at the very top of the selected list. Use the up/down arrows if necessary to adjust its priority above any other active packs.
- Click "Done" to apply the changes. The game will reload resources, and upon returning to the menu, all text should now reflect the new serif style.
If you do not see the changes immediately, double-check the load order. If another resource pack is sitting above the Ashen font in the list, it will override the font definitions, reverting your text to the default or that pack's specific style. This prioritization system is key to mastering resource pack combinations.
